$100 Question - Design

A maximum of 1:20 slope is the definition of this

answer back to categories

$100 Answer - Design

What is an accessible route?

back to categories

$200 Question - Design

Included in the definition of this is the requirement for

handrails and a slope not to exceed 1:12

answer back to categories

$200 Answer - Design

What is a ramp?

back to categories

$300 Question - Design

The clear width of an accessible route is this wide

answer back to categories

$300 Answer - Design

What is 36 inches?

back to categories

$400 Question - Design

This striped area is next to an accessible parking stall to

provide entry and exit from a vehicle

answer back to categories

$400 Answer - Design

What is an access aisle?

back to categories

$500 Question - Design

An accessible surface must have these three characteristics

answer back to categories

$500 Answer - Design

What is firm, stable, and slip resistant?

$100 Question - Employment

This title of the ADA prohibits discrimination in employment

against persons with disabilities

answer back to categories

$100 Answer - Employment

What is Title I?

back to categories

$200 Question - Employment

This is a modification or adjustment to a job to enable a qualified individual with a

disability to work

answer back to categories

$200 Answer - Employment

What is a reasonable accommodation?

back to categories

$300 Question - Employment

An employer may ask an employee about his or her

disability at this stage of a job offer

answer back to categories

$300 Answer - Employment

What is “after a conditional job offer”?

back to categories

$400 Question - Employment

This is one of the two legal defenses for not providing a reasonable accommodation

answer back to categories

$400 Answer - Employment

What is undue hardship? or What is direct threat?

back to categories

$500 Question - Employment

An individual must be able to perform this in order to be

considered “qualified to do a job”

answer back to categories

$500 Answer - Employment

What is “perform the essential functions of the

job”?

$100 Question – Communication Access

This device used with a phone allows a deaf, hard of hearing, or speech-impaired person to

use the phone

answer back to categories

$100 Answer – Communication Access

What is a TTY? (Text telephone, teletypewriter)

back to categories

$200 Question – Communication Access

FM, Infrared, Induction Loops, 3-D Loops, and Telecoils are

types of these

answer back to categories

$200 Answer – Communication Access

What is an assistive listening system?

back to categories

$300 Question – Communication Access

These are three types of captioning

answer back to categories

$300 Answer – Communication Access

What are open captioning, closed captioning, and real

time captioning?

back to categories

$400 Question – Communication Access

This type of exhibit is especially helpful for people who are blind

or visually impaired because they can touch it

answer back to categories

$400 Answer – Communication Access

What is a tactile exhibit?

back to categories

$500 Question – Communication Access

Interpreters, note-takers, computer-aided transcription, amplifiers, and video displays

are examples of these

answer back to categories

$500 Answer – Communication Access

What are auxiliary aids and services?

$100 Question – Program and Services

These types of animals must be permitted on a property even if

you have a ‘no pets’ policy

answer back to categories

$100 Answer – Programs and Services

What is a service animal?

back to categories

$200 Question – Programs and Services

This is an illegal extra cost for an aid or service such as

charging for a sign language interpreter

answer back to categories

$200 Answer – Recreation Standards

What is a surcharge?

back to categories

$300 Question – Programs and Services

Public entities must provide this type of alternate transportation

if they offer a public transit system

answer back to categories

$300 Answer – Programs and Services

What is paratransit?

back to categories

$400 Question – Programs and Services

This is the primary agency responsible for enforcement of

the ADA Titles II and III for access to programs and services

answer

back to categories

$400 Answer – Programs and Services

What is the U.S. Department of Justice?

back to categories

$500 Question – Programs and Services

State and local government agencies must have one of these to guide their facility improvements to remove

barriers to programs

answer back to categories

$500 Answer – Programs and Services

What is a Transition Plan?

$100 Question – The Law

The ADA became a law in this year

answer back to categories

$100 Answer – The Law

What is 1990?

back to categories

$200 Question – The Law

The ADA is patterned after a civil rights law

answer back to categories

$200 Answer – The Law

What is the Civil Rights Act of 1964? or What is Section 504 of

the Rehabilitation Act?

back to categories

$300 Question – The Law

The ADA does not apply to this level of government

answer back to categories

$300 Answer – The Law

What is the federal government?

back to categories

$400 Question – The Law

This Federal Law complements the ADA by covering

discrimination in multi-family dwelling units

answer back to categories

$400 Answer – The Law

What is the Fair Housing Amendments Act?

back to categories

$500 Question – The Law

This Federal Law complements the ADA by covering

discrimination in air travel

answer back to categories

$500 Answer – The Law

What is the Air Carriers Access Act?
